Hossein Kakejani; Alireza Farsi; Behrouz Abdoli; Hamidollah Hassanlouei – International Journal of Disability, Development and Education, 2025
The aim of the present study was to determine the effect of the game-based training program on fundamental movement skills (FMS) and working memory (WM) in male children with Down syndrome. Twenty-one children ages 9 to 11 years were assigned to either a Game-Based Training (GBT) or No-Training (NT) group. The GBT group participated in 12 sessions…

Filippi, Roberto; Ceccolini, Andrea; Booth, Elizabeth; Shen, Chen; Thomas, Michael S.C.; Toledano, Mireille B.; Dumontheil, Iroise – International Journal of Bilingual Education and Bilingualism, 2022
Previous research has shown that cognitive development is sensitive to socio-economic status (SES) and multilinguistic experiences. However, these effects are difficult to disentangle and SES may modulate the effects of multilingualism. The present study used data from a large cohort of pupils who took part in the Study of Cognition, Adolescents…
